Service Delivery Support Officer
2 weeks ago
The Service Delivery Support Officer manages scheduling and coordination of all courses and prisoner services for the Correctional Centre including support services for classroom and other educational facilities.
**In this role you will**:
Establish key communication processes to coordinate links between the correctional centre, service providers and probation and parole services to ensure appropriate services and support are being providedMonitor and analyse data to ensure identification and allocation of prisoners to the appropriate services, both internal and externalCollation and provision of data and reports on service delivery performanceEstablish effective working relationships between QCS and service providers to support the release planning processProvide guidance to contracted service providers in relation to identified service delivery needsContribute to the ongoing review of the service delivery through monitoring the efficiency and relevance of service provision, identifying any gaps in service delivery and advising on improvementsLiaise with service providers in relation to induction training, custodial awareness training, criminal history checks, security access to centre, room setup, and resource requirementsProvide ongoing support and practical assistance to external and internal service providersMaintain waiting lists for programs and courses outside of those managed centrally, including programs and services for prisoners on remand and those with short sentences.Schedules and notifies prisoners of course/service allocation and responds to queries in relation to availabilityAllocation of prisoners to programs including making offers and recording outcomesManage schedules and any scheduling tool for classrooms and other educational/program areas, including development of master schedule and setup informationMaintains up to date and accurate records of program and service participation including in the Integrated Offender Management system (IOMS) and/or alternate systems as requiredCarry out administrative duties as requestedProvide information technology support and undertake device security checksEnsure the security and confidentiality of QCS property and information
**The essential requirements for this role are**:
Highly developed skills at a competent level with the willingness to learn new IT skills and use internal information management databases as well as Microsoft Office softwareDemonstrated experience to ensure tasks are completed within the required deadlines and in accordance with all relevant policies and proceduresAbility to demonstrate a range of problem-solving strategies and show initiative in identifying and solving problems both independently and as a team memberAbility to use judgement and discretion with confidential informationHigh level oral and written communication skills for gathering and providing information both over the phone and in person, to a range of stakeholders and ability to summarise information and dataAbility to acquire knowledge of relevant acts and regulationsThis work is licensed under a Creative Commons Attribution 3.0 Australia License.
